There is always more to a story than meets the eye, isn't there? If we are talking about the same house, I've walked that house and it is one that was modified for the original purchaser with changes that may not be desirable to everyone. This could well be the reason for the reduction in price. While I did like the Westchester area, I wasn't too excited about the street that house is on either. I've viewed that floor plan in other parts of Grand Prairie and they are priced much higher than the one in question. I think they have about three or four subdivisions in Grand Praire, and the one where this house is located may well be the lowest cost of all. For example, according to Grand's website, the same house in Mira Lagos is nearly $100k more.
EDIT: I just went to the website and it appears the subdivision where this house is located is now closed out. Could be a bargain for someone.

Grand Homes - wouldn't recommend
I bought a home from GrandHomes about 1 year ago. They built a very poor quality house. I had numerous tickets (100s honestly) to address those issues and some of them are not even addressed. Warranty does seem to work okay but they try to escape on a lot of issues without fixing them. They act like they are respecting the customer but they don't have any values literally. Their upgrades are very expensive and don't get cheated by their great looking model homes. Actual house delivered will not be anywhere closer to that model home. Forget about standard features home with no upgrades...it comes like a 4 wheel car with no engine inside. They installed a wood floor at my house and it is of cheap quality. I could have paid 50% less outside for a better quality floor. I wouldn't recommend GrandHomes.
